#5d4528 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#5d4528 is composed of 36.5% red, 27.1% green and 15.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 25.8% magenta, 57% yellow and 63.5% black. It has a hue angle of 32.8 degrees, a saturation of 39.8% and a lightness of 26.1%. #5d4528 color hex could be obtained by blending #ba8a50 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#663333.

Shades and Tints of #5d4528

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0b0805 is the darkest color, while #fefdfc is the lightest one.

Tones of #5d4528

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#434342 is the less saturated color, while #814804 is the most saturated one.
